CITY OF POOLER

PLANNING AND ZONING MINUTES

AUGUST 24, 1998

 

 

The regularly scheduled meeting of the Pooler Planning and Zoning Commission was held on

Monday, August 24, 1998 at Pooler City Hall. Members present were: Holly Young, Don

Taylor, Fleta Pepper, Gay Tucciarone and Robert Drewry. Jackie Carver, Zoning Administrator,

Tim Inglis, City Planner/Inspector and Councilman Jim Poteet were also present. Chairman

Robert Drewry called the meeting to order at 6 p.m.

 

The minutes of the previous meeting were approved upon a motion made by Holly Young and seconded by Gay Tucciarone.

 

1. Strickland Oil Company Site Plan Review. Marvin Strickland presented his site plan for a proposed convenient store with gas pumps to be built at the corner of Skinner Avenue and Highway 80. Mayor and Council approved a setback variance for this project on July 6, 1998. The board had been given a copy of the letter from John Kern's office addressing most of the engineering comments by Hussey, Gay, Bell & DeYoung, Inc. Pending items of concern were the D. 0. T. driveway permit. drainage calculations and on-site storm water detention. Mr. Strickland stated he had met with City Manager Dennis Baxter and Bill Lovett of Hussey, Gay Bell, and DeYoung, Inc. at the proposed site. He further stated as a result of this meeting, the city engineer determined due to existing drainage from adjacent properties, on-site storm water detention would not be required. After some discussion. a motion was made by Don Taylor to approve the site plan subject to all the comments being addressed prior to review by Mayor and Council. Motion was seconded by Fleta Pepper and passed without opposition.

 

3.  Herbert and Gladys Smith's request for a variance to I)lace a manufactured home at

1336 5. Rogers Street. Maurine Tapley, petitioner's daughter. presented this request to the board.  She stated her parent's home requires immediate replacement or extensive repairs. Mrs. Tapley explained the expense and time involved in replacing or making necessary repairs along with relocating her parents for an extended period at their age. would result in an unnecessary hardship. Several property owners spoke in favor of the variance request and no opposition was expressed. A motion was made by Fleta Pepper to grant the variance request for placement of a manufactured home at 1336 South Rogers Street to Mr. & Mrs. Herbert Smith for their personal use only, not to be extended beyond their lifetime. Motion was seconded by Gay Tucciarone and passed without opposition.
